I have to contradict @saj14saj here. I have frequently had bread made with underdeveloped gluten (my grandma uses AP flour and tends to knead very short, 2-3 minutes per hand, and use very short proofing times). The bread is soft and cakelike, but it has no trouble rising, and it is neither flat nor dense.
On the other hand, I have had bread with exactly the same symptoms as yours - first feeling great, then left out for a long time to proof. After that, it looks good, but one touch makes it collapse into itself. The reason was very clear: overproofing. There is no doubt that underdeveloped gluten cannot have been a factor in my case. First, I am experienced enough to know when my gluten is developed - the bread was kneaded well beyond windowpane test. Second, it was a large batch of dough. I baked the first loaf at the optimal time and it rose just fine and had a nice texture with traceable gluten sheets through the crumb. It was the second loaf, which I baked a few hours later (and the proofing loaf spent them in a 30 degrees celsius kitchen in summer) which made the trouble. The dough had exactly the "loose" feel you describe, unlike the normal, springy feel before the proofing. It collapsed on touch and would not rise at all. It also had a very strong yeast fermentation taste, unlike the other loaf.
From your description and my experience, my conclusion is that overproofing until your starter died in its own waste products is the most likely culprit. The simple answer would be to not let it sit out overnight. The right amount of time to let it sit would depend on the room temperature, on the amount of starter you used, but also its leavening strength, and that is a bit hard to judge for a newly created starter. My best suggestion is to use trial and error and maybe bake 4 hours after knocking instead of 8 next time, and the time after that adjusting with a smaller increment in the right direction depending on whether the bread turns out overproofed or underrisen.
I agree with many elements of the previous answers -- it could be due to the wet dough "resealing" and/or to the crust hardening too early and preventing further expansion. Doing a more horizontal slash than a vertical one is helpful to get good "ears," and extra moisture will keep the crust softer for a little longer to get more oven spring.
Frankly, although I did it for years, I don't find the plant sprayer method to do very much -- and if you're opening the oven periodically to spray in the first few minutes, you could be losing significant heat that could actually reduce oven spring. I concur with the steam pan method or using an enclosed pot. Note that pots don't have to be cast iron: any enclosed pot will significantly improve your crust as long as it is oven-safe at the baking temperature.
That said, I think this particular problem is difficult to troubleshoot without observing your specific loaves and slashing technique. Slashing deeper (whether vertically or horizontally) is definitely NOT always the answer and can actually deflate your loaves significantly if done incorrectly. With proper hydration, shaping, and oven steaming, it's very possible for quite shallow slashes to lead to great expansion. (As an aside, serrated knives are also about preference -- if you don't keep your straight-edge knives very sharp, serrated may be a better choice. However, they can leave your slashes jagged on the final loaf, which may not be as pretty and may result in unevenness for shallower cuts. I keep some of my straight-edge kitchen knives really sharp so they can be used for things like this.)
A lot of it depends on shaping and the stage of proofing your dough is in when you bake it, as well as the hydration. If you do a very thorough shaping (i.e., preshaping, bench rest, then very tight shaping of the final loaves), the outermost skin of the loaf may be very taut. Even a shallow slash could be enough to allow the loaves to open up significantly. If, on the other hand, you do a very gently shaping (little or no pre-shaping, trying very hard not to deflate the dough at all), the "skin" will not have the same characteristics and deeper slashes may be necessary. (As an example of this, you might consult the different advice given by Peter Reinhard and Jeffrey Hamelman -- the latter emphasizes detailed and tight shaping and thus advocates very shallow slashing; the former encourages gentle handling when shaping and advocates somewhat deeper cuts.)
The stage of proofing is also critical here: a loaf that is somewhat underproofed will likely have a more taut skin but will also hold its shape better even with deeper slashes. If the loaves are somewhat overproofed, they have a better chance of deflating or at least losing height with deeper slashing. The apparent moisture of the dough and its susceptibility to "reseal" the cut will also change depending on proofing stage.
Again, there are a lot of factors to consider. I would pay particular attention to the behavior of the loaves right after you slash them. Do the slashes spread significantly immediately (indicating a taut surface)? Or do they just remain close together (and thus risk re-sealing)? If you slash more deeply, does the loaf deflate? And if it does so, does it seem to reinflate in the oven, or do your permanently lose height? These observations can help troubleshoot the exact issue. A final concern -- sometimes if the dough is likely to reseal, waiting too long between slashing and getting the loaf into the oven can be a problem. A few seconds should not be an issue, but if you're taking a few minutes to slash and load a few loaves before getting them to the oven, that can be enough time for some cuts to close up again.

Smaller breads are usually called rolls or sometimes buns. There are also a lot of names for specific kinds of rolls, beyond obvious things like "sourdough rolls".
You can certainly take an existing recipe and just form in to more, smaller pieces, and reducing baking time. They'll look funny if you just cut it into pieces, though; you should reform them into something rounder.
It's hard to say exactly how much less baking time it'll take, since it depends on exactly how small you make them. It might be anywhere from roughly a quarter to half the original baking time, and especially for smaller rolls with shorter baking times, you'd probably want to increase the temperature so they'll still brown by the time they're done. Very small ones will be on the low end of the time range, and need more increase in temperature; larger ones will take longer and not need as much temperature increase.
Given all that, you might want to just look for a recipe for rolls that suits you. Simpler, less chance of messing up!
